Laser focus spot measurement in a tilted geometry using optical fiber - power meter system
Abstract
The spot size a focused helium neon laser oriented at an angle with respect to the optical axis of a focusing lens has been determined using scanning optical fiber - power meter system. The spot size was measured by obtaining the laser beam waists at planes located at some distance after the lens. Using the laser beam waists, we simulated the beam profile for a focused laser beam tilted at an angle. The obtained data shows promising potential of the optical fiber - power meter system in determining the spot size of a focused high - powered laser beam.
